Voting alignment

Cameron Thomas and Kate Osborne voted the same way 28% of the time, based on 198 shared comparable votes.

55 same votes 143 different votes 198 shared votes

Alignment only includes divisions where both MPs recorded an Aye or No vote. Tellers, absences, abstentions, and missing votes are excluded.
